Highlights
Are people in Freeport older or younger than people in Boone?
- The Median Age in Freeport is 26.8 years older than in Boone.

Are housing costs cheaper in Freeport or Boone?
- Freeport housing costs are 38.9% more expensive than Boone hous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Freeport or Boone?
- The average commute for residents of Freeport is 7.8 minutes longer than it is for residents of Boone.

Things to do in Boone?
Boone, NC is a small city located in the Blue Ridge Mountains of North Carolina. Surrounded by out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ing and mountain biking, Boone has become a popular destination for tourists and outdoor enthusiasts. The town itself offers a variety of restaurants, shopping and entertainment venues. With its friendly people and breathtaking scenery, Boone is the perfect place to visit or live.
